US envoys meet Netanyahu as Israel bombs Gaza

Jan 26, 2026

Washington [US], January 26: United States envoy Steve Witkoff says he and his colleague Jared Kushner have held "constructive" talks with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, as Israel continues its deadly bombardment of the besieged Gaza Strip.
In a short statement on Sunday, Witkoff said the "positive" discussion focused on "the continued progress and implementation planning for Phase 2 of President Trump's 20-Point Plan for Gaza", which the US and Israel are advancing in "close partnership".
Witkoff added "broader regional issues" were also discussed in the meeting on Saturday, a likely reference to heightened tensions between the US and Iran.
Israel, in the meantime, continues bombarding Gaza despite agreeing to a ceasefire in its genocidal war, committing near-daily violations of the October 10 agreement brokered by the US. Medical sources at al-Shifa Hospital in the city said at least one person had been killed and 15 wounded throughout the day, Mahmoud added. (Agencies)
